A | ALLENDALE, Mich. -- Prosecutors are recommending a prison sentence for a former Republican candidate for Michigan governor who pleaded guilty to a misdemeanor for his participation in the 2021 U.S. Capitol riot.Ryan Kelley's arrest in 2022 gave his campaign a burst of notoriety in a conservative multi-candidate field, but he ended up finishing far behind other supporters of former President Donald Trump in the GOP primary election. Conservative commentator Tudor Dixon won the Republican primary but ultimately lost to incumbent Gov.
